updated on Wed Jan 18 08:00:29 UTC 2012
[aur-mirror.git] / apitrace-git / PKGBUILD
blob28aa645b460052b18c39855523df553f535ce36f
1 # Contributor: Luca Bennati <lucak3 AT gmail DOT com>
2 # Maintainer: Glaucous <glakke1 at gmail dot com>
4 pkgname=apitrace-git
5 pkgver=20111106
6 pkgrel=1
7 pkgdesc="Graphics API Tracing"
8 arch=('x86_64' 'i686')
9 url="https://github.com/apitrace/apitrace"
10 license=('BSD')
11 depends=('python2' 'libgl')
12 makedepends=('cmake>=2.8' 'git')
13 optdepends=('qt: GUI support' 'qjson: GUI support')
14 provides=('apitrace')
15 conflicts=('apitrace')
16 source=('LICENSE')
17 md5sums=('85536f1e169f24a548762a3cbbcd227c')
19 _gitroot='git://github.com/apitrace/apitrace.git'
20 _gitname='apitrace'
22 build() {
23   cd "${srcdir}"
24   msg "Connecting to GIT server...."
26   if [[ -d "${_gitname}" ]]; then
27     cd "${_gitname}" && git pull origin
28     msg "The local files are updated."
29   else
30     git clone "${_gitroot}" "${_gitname}"
31   fi
33   msg "GIT checkout done or server timeout"
34   msg "Starting build..."
36   cd "${srcdir}"
37 #unset LDFLAGS
38   cmake -H"${_gitname}" -Bbuild -DCMAKE_INSTALL_PREFIX=/usr -DPYTHON_EXECUTABLE='/usr/bin/python2.7'
39   make -C build
42 package() {
43   cd "${srcdir}/build"
44   make DESTDIR="${pkgdir}/" install
46   mkdir -p "${pkgdir}"/usr/share/licenses/apitrace
47   msg "Moving LICENSE to /usr/share/licenses"
48   mv "${pkgdir}"/usr/share/{doc,licenses}/apitrace/LICENSE
51 # vim:set ts=2 sw=2 et: